Understanding the In The Case Of Minors Surname, First Name, Address if Different From Applicant's And Nationality Of
The form titled "In The Case Of Minors Surname, First Name, Address if Different From Applicant's And Nationality Of" is primarily used to gather essential information about minors when they are involved in legal or administrative processes. This form typically requires the minor's surname and first name, which are crucial for identification purposes. Additionally, if the minor's address differs from that of the applicant, this information must be provided to ensure accurate correspondence and legal standing.
Moreover, the nationality of the minor is required, as it may impact various legal rights and responsibilities. Understanding these details is vital for compliance with regulations and for ensuring that the minor's interests are adequately represented in any proceedings.

Required Documents for the In The Case Of Minors Surname, First Name, Address if Different From Applicant's And Nationality Of
To complete this form, certain documents may be required to support the information provided. These typically include:
- A copy of the minor's birth certificate or legal identification to verify their name and date of birth.
- Proof of residency, such as a utility bill or lease agreement, if the minor's address differs from the applicant's.
- Documentation of nationality, which may include a passport or other official identification.
Having these documents ready can streamline the process and ensure that the form is filled out correctly.
